Carlos Measured the link of a book to be 21 cm the actual length of a book is 23cm which of these is closest to the percent erro

r for Diego's measurements
Mathematics
1 answer:
Wewaii [24]3 years ago
5 0

Answer: 8.70%

Step-by-step explanation:

Percent error is calculated as:

= (Accepted value - Experimental value) / Accepted value × 100

= (23 - 21) / 23 × 100

= 2/23 × 100

= 8.70%

The percentage error is 8.70%

What is the area of this triangle? base = 5 mm Height = 6mm
hichkok12 [17]
Area of a triangle can be found using the equation base x height / 2 

(5)(6)/2 = 30/2 = 15

The area of the triangle is 15mm
